@esaruoho We are sorry for the misleading response on Youtube.
While it is indeed possible to connect your iPad to a TV screen and present from the tablet, you need a PC with the desktop application installed if you would like to use your phone as a clicker.

Hello @Oleksandra_Keudel1, please make sure your devices meet the system requirements mentioned in this article tutorial. Also I would recommend not pairing the devices via Bluetooth manually. Just make sure it is enabled on both devices and they should connect automatically. In case the problem persists please restart the devices and log out then back into your Prezi account.
